Requirements for sealing off on-site electrical distribution boxes

Sealing electrical distribution boxes requires using appropriate materials and techniques to prevent air, moisture, dust, and flame propagation while maintaining compliance with safety standards.Purpose of SealingSealing electrical boxes serves multiple purposes: improving energy efficiency by preventing air leaks, protecting against moisture and corrosion, preventing pest intrusion, and ensuring fire and explosion safety in hazardous locations ( ). Proper sealing also helps maintain the integrity of fire-rated walls and enclosures and protects sensitive electronics in control cabinets ( ).Materials and MethodsNon-hardening electrical putty or duct seal compound: Used to seal wire entries inside the box. It remains flexible for future adjustments and provides an air-tight seal ( ).Fire-rated caulk: Applied around the box flange where it meets the wall to maintain fire resistance. Elastomeric sealants with UL or ASTM ratings are recommended ( ).Minimal-expansion, fire-rated foam: Fills larger voids or deep wall penetrations without distorting the box. Fire-block or fire-rated foams with intumescent properties are essential ( ).Polyurethane or silicone sealing foams: Protect electronics in control cabinets from moisture and dust, preventing corrosion and malfunctions ( ).Gaskets and cable glands: Match the required IP or NEMA rating to block dust, water, and contaminants. Silicone sealant can support the seal but should not replace rated gaskets or glands ( ).Installation ConsiderationsDe-energize circuits before sealing to prevent electrical shock ( ).Clean surfaces around the box to ensure proper adhesion of sealants or foams ( ).Apply sealants evenly and avoid over-expansion that could distort the box or surrounding materials ( ).Use painter's tape to create clean lines and prevent excess foam from spreading ( ).Code and Safety RequirementsHazardous locations (Class I, Division 1 and 2): Conduit seals must prevent flame propagation and minimize gas or vapor migration. Sealing compounds must be listed, installed per instructions, and meet minimum thickness and melting point requirements ( ).Conduit fill limits: Typically, no more than 25–40% of the conduit cross-sectional area should be filled to allow effective sealing around conductors ( ).Inspection and maintenance: Regularly check seals, especially in outdoor or washdown environments, to maintain IP/NEMA protection levels ( ).SummaryEffective sealing of electrical distribution boxes combines appropriate materials (putty, caulk, foam, gaskets), correct installation techniques, and compliance with safety codes. This ensures protection against air, moisture, dust, pests, fire, and explosion hazards while maintaining energy efficiency and equipment reliability.
